SVG 和 VG 矢量图形文件格式之间的差异

已发表: 2023-02-10

作为矢量图形文件格式,SVG 和 VG 都具有某些共同特征,例如能够在不损失质量的情况下缩放图像。 但是,这两种格式之间也存在一些重要差异。 SVG 是 Web 上矢量图形的标准格式,并受到所有现代 Web 浏览器的支持。 SVG 文件也比 VG 文件更小、更简洁,这使得它们下载速度更快且更易于使用。 VG 是 Adob​​e 开发的专有格式,只有少数软件程序支持。 VG 文件通常也比 SVG 文件更大、更复杂,使它们更适合高分辨率打印。

矢量图形一词源自拉丁词 svega。 这种文件格式对网络友好,可用于在线渲染二维图像。 您可以使用 Adob​​e Illustrator、CorelDraw、Adobe Photoshop、Microsoft Visio 和 GIMP 等图像编辑软件创建SVG 文件。 即使您不知道如何使用这些程序但擅长编码,也可以使用 XML 创建 SVG。 XML——允许以数字方式发送数据的标记语言——是 SVG 文件的来源。 它们用于信息图表和插图,因为它们的文本可以被谷歌等搜索引擎读取。 使用 VS Code、Atom 或 Sublime Text 等代码编辑器时,您可以打开 SVG 文件。

作为图形对象,您可以使用 SVG 创建三种类型:矢量图形形状(例如,由直线和曲线构成的路径)、图像和文本。 图形对象的使用允许对它们进行分组、样式化、转换和合成,从而允许包含它们之前呈现的属性。

通常,SVG 和 PNG 是矢量文件,而光栅文件是光栅文件。

Svg 文件是否有另一个名称?

Svg 文件是否有另一个名称?
图片来源 – pinimg.com

svg 文件没有其他名称。

万维网联盟 (W3C) 创建了一种称为 SVG 的二维矢量图形格式。 XML 格式以文本格式存储有关照片的信息。 图形专业人员使用它们来存储 Web 图形、移动应用程序和打印图形。 浏览器是可扩展的,可以使用 CSS 和脚本语言(如 JavaScript)进行调整。 您可以使用多种图像编辑器打开 SVG 文件,包括 Adob​​e Illustrator 和 Inkscape。 许多游戏,包括 Quake III:Team Arena、重返德军总部和侠盗猎车手 2,都使用保存的游戏文件 (SV)。 可以使用 Adob​​e Illustrator、CorelDRAW Graphics Suite、GIMP 和Inkscape 程序将这些文件转换为其他格式。 可能需要使用多个程序才能打开或编辑 SVG 文件。

由于其诸多优点,该文件格式正变得越来越流行。 现在是时候将 SVG 合并到您的设计中了; 如果你这样做,你不会后悔的。

矢量文件是 Svg 吗?

svg(可缩放矢量图形)文件格式是一种可用于显示图形的文件类型。 矢量图像可以用点、线、曲线、形状(多边形)等几何形式的离散对象来表示图像的各个部分。 这些表格中的每一个都可以单独编辑。

Svgs 需要标题吗?

与图像的 alt 属性用于描述其文本的方式相同,SVG 的 title> 标签应该简短。 您可以在SVG 标签中使用 arialabel by attribute 来指示标题是什么。 如果有多个形状,则可以为每个形状组中的每个形状添加一个标题标签。

矢量文件和 Svg 是一样的吗?

矢量文件和 Svg 是一样的吗?
图片来源 – googleusercontent.com

矢量文件和 svg 文件之间没有区别。 它们都是矢量图形文件,可以在 Adob​​e Illustrator 等矢量编辑软件中打开。

PostScript 文件是一种保存为单个文件并包含低分辨率预览的 PostScript 程序。 sva 文件可以在不损失图像质量的情况下缩放到合适的大小。 如果这样做,您可能能够制作合成图像或将它们组合起来用于印刷材料。 在 Mac 上的 Adob​​e Illustrator 中保存为 EPS 的任何文件都可以在 PC 上查看,前提是该文件之前已导入。 大多数图形设计应用程序允许您修改 EPS 文件的文本、线条或颜色,但页面布局应用程序不允许。 两种文件类型之间的主要区别在于它们作为应用程序的用途。

文本对象由字符、笔画和填充字符的组合组成。 任何类型的数字图像都可以用多种方式表示。 因为 SVG 文件是矢量文件,所以您可以创建高质量的图形而不会降低质量。 许多 Adob​​e 产品,包括 Photoshop 和 Illustrator,都使用DrawElements SVG 库作为矢量绘图库。 如果您正在寻找一种立即制作矢量图形的简便方法,那么这款软件就是您的最佳选择。

Svg 文件的好处

基于矢量的图像文件通常称为 SVG,因为它们由几何形状而不是光栅化图像组成。 因此,可以在不丢失分辨率的情况下编辑和缩放 SVG 文件。 此外,由于 SVG 由 XML 构成,因此可以在文本编辑器或电子表格中对其进行编辑。
在 PNG 和 s vo vo 之间进行选择时,考虑相同的因素至关重要。 这两种格式都是基于矢量的,可以在文本编辑器或电子表格中进行编辑,两者都支持透明度。 另一方面,PNG 格式更适合光栅透明度,并且是将在 Web 上使用的徽标和图形的更好选择。


Svg 有什么用

Svg 有什么用
图片来源 – pinimg.com

SVG,即可缩放矢量图形,是一种用于二维矢量图形的文件格式。 它是一种基于 XML 的文件格式,用于创建静态或动画图像。

近年来有许多 SVG 文件的替代品和竞争者可用,证明了它们的广泛吸引力。 HTML5 和 js 是 SVG 的两个流行替代品,市场上还有 Modernizr 和 Lodash。
SVG 的好处很多,使其成为网页和应用程序设计的热门选择。 它可以根据图像的分辨率放大或缩小。 因为这些文件很容易使用文本编辑器进行编辑,它们也可以使用 JavaScript 制作动画。

Svg 文件示例

SVG 文件是由 Adob​​e Illustrator 软件创建的图形交换格式 (GIF) 文件。 它是一种标准的 Web 图形文件格式。 SVG 文件可以在任何文本编辑器中创建,但通常是在矢量图形编辑器中创建的,例如 Adob​​e Illustrator、Inkscape 或 CorelDRAW。

XML 用于生成可缩放矢量图形 (SVG) 文件。 使用用于创建 SVG 文件的 JavaScript 工具,您可以直接或以编程方式创建和编辑文件。 如果您无法使用插画或素描,Inkscape 是一个不错的选择。 单击此处了解有关在 Adob​​e Illustrator 中创建 SVG 文件的更多信息。 使用SVG 代码按钮时,将生成文件的文本。 该程序将在默认文本编辑器中自动启动。 这将允许您预览最终文件,甚至可以复制并粘贴其中的文本。

当 XML 声明和注释从文件顶部移除时,它们会更加明显。 在创建任何类型的动画或样式时,最好将形状排列成可以使用 CSS 或 JavaScript 设置样式或动画的组。 您将无法用您的图形填充 Illustrator 中的整个画板(白色背景)。 在保存图形之前,您应该确保画板正确定位在图稿上。

Svg 文件的用途是什么?

SVG 文件格式是在网站上显示二维图形、图表和插图的高效便捷工具。 此外,作为矢量文件,还可以在不损失任何分辨率的情况下放大或缩小它。

如何创建 Svg 文件?

创建和编辑 SVG 文件也是如此; 只需打开文本编辑器并选择适当的文件即可。 您还可以在 svg 元素和屏幕的其余部分之间添加其他svg 形状和路径,例如圆形、矩形、椭圆形或路径。 使用各种 JavaScript 库,您还可以在您的网站上绘制和操作 SVG 文件。

Png 文件是 Svg 文件吗?

PNG 文件可以承受非常高的分辨率,但不能无限扩展。 另一方面,矢量文件由线、点、形状和从复杂数学网络构建的算法组成。 它们可以长到任何尺寸而不会失去分辨率。

Svg 图像

SVG 图像是矢量图形图像,可以缩放到任意大小而不会降低其质量。 SVG 图像通常用于网站上的徽标和插图。

在图形中,矢量图形称为可缩放矢量图形 (SVG)。 允许创建基于矢量的图形的可扩展标记语言 (XML) 采用这种格式。 在 CSS 和 HTML 中使用 sva 图像是一种选择。 本教程将向您展示如何使用六种不同的方法。 SVG 可以用作 CSS 背景图像。 要将图像添加到 HTML 文档,您可以使用 >img> 标签。 如前所述,这次我们使用 CSS 而不是 HTML 来进行更多定制。

此外,SVG 元素可用于将图像添加到网页。 <object> 函数可以在任何支持可缩放矢量图形 (SVG) 标准的浏览器中使用。 图像可以在 HTML 和 CSS 中与 HTML/CSS >embed 元素一起使用,使用语法 >embed src HTML happy.svg />。 根据 MDN 的说法,依赖 >embed> 通常不是一个好主意,因为现代浏览器不支持浏览器插件。

PNG比。 Jpegs:哪种图像文件格式更好?

在图像文件格式方面,有多种选择。 PNG 和 JPEG 格式都很流行,尽管它们各有优缺点。
由于 PNG 支持 alpha 通道,因此可以使用此文件格式以更透明的方式创建需要透明度的徽标和图形。 它们也比 JPEG 小,因此是 Web 图形的更好选择。
与 sva 相比,不需要透明度的图像优于需要透明度的图像。 因为它们可以在文本编辑器中编辑,所以它们也更加通用。 但是,它们可以比 JPEG 更大。